Output 58d13a9cd3b0858bd897cc9cb19cada61f1034125b587a93c732de1f335bd07d:40

value
5209529
script pubkey
OP_0 OP_PUSHBYTES_20 8c39b8d139537203f9d12a277e7d7ae4c2b35de9
address
bc1q3sum35fe2deq87w39gnhult6unptxh0f22aetu
transaction
58d13a9cd3b0858bd897cc9cb19cada61f1034125b587a93c732de1f335bd07d
confirmations
151748
spent
true